Two diagonals of an isosceles trapezium are x cm and (3x – 8) cm. Find the value of x.

उत्तर
∵ The diagonals of an isosceles trapezium are of equal length

∴ 3x – 8 = x
⇒ 3x – x = 8 cm
⇒ 2x = 8 cm
⇒ x = 4 cm
∴ The value of x is 4 cm
